为Hermes Agent配置Taotoken作为自定义模型供应商的详细步骤
告别海外账号与网络限制稳定直连全球优质大模型限时半价接入中。 点击领取海量免费额度为Hermes Agent配置Taotoken作为自定义模型供应商的详细步骤Hermes Agent是一个流行的智能体开发框架它支持通过配置自定义的模型供应商来接入不同的模型服务。如果你希望使用Taotoken平台提供的多模型服务来驱动你的Hermes Agent应用本文将详细介绍如何将其配置为custom提供方。整个过程主要涉及正确设置provider类型、base_url以及API密钥。1. 理解配置的核心参数在Hermes Agent的配置体系中使用自定义供应商custom provider意味着你需要明确指定API的端点地址和认证方式。对于Taotoken平台你需要关注以下两个核心参数provider 必须设置为custom。base_url 这是请求发送的目标地址。由于Taotoken提供的是OpenAI兼容的API因此此处的地址需要包含/v1路径。正确的格式是https://taotoken.net/api/v1。请务必注意这与某些工具如Claude Code使用的Anthropic兼容地址不同后者末尾没有/v1。API密钥通常通过环境变量OPENAI_API_KEY来传递Hermes Agent在发起请求时会自动使用该变量中的值。2. 通过TaoToken CLI交互菜单配置推荐对于希望快速完成配置的用户使用TaoToken官方命令行工具是最简便的方式。该工具提供了交互式菜单可以引导你完成Hermes Agent的配置。首先你需要安装或运行这个CLI工具。你可以选择全局安装或者直接使用npx命令。# 方式一全局安装 npm install -g taotoken/taotoken # 方式二使用npx无需安装 npx taotoken/taotoken安装或确认工具可用后在终端中运行taotoken命令。你会看到一个交互式菜单选择与Hermes Agent相关的选项。工具会依次提示你输入以下信息你的Taotoken平台API Key。你想要使用的模型ID例如claude-sonnet-4-6你可以在Taotoken的模型广场查看所有可用模型。工具会自动将必要的配置包括正确的base_url和模型信息写入Hermes Agent的配置文件或环境变量中。这个过程自动化了手动编辑配置文件的步骤减少了出错的可能。3. 手动编辑配置文件与环境变量如果你更倾向于手动控制配置或者需要集成到现有的配置管理流程中可以按照以下步骤操作。通常Hermes Agent的配置可以通过项目根目录下的配置文件如hermes.config.js或hermes.config.ts或环境变量文件如.env来管理。你需要确保配置中包含了自定义供应商的信息。一个典型的配置示例如下具体格式请以Hermes Agent最新文档为准// hermes.config.js 示例片段 export default { provider: custom, base_url: https://taotoken.net/api/v1, // 模型信息可能在具体的Agent配置中指定 // model: claude-sonnet-4-6, };同时你需要在项目的环境变量文件中设置API密钥。创建一个.env文件如果不存在并添加以下内容# .env 文件 OPENAI_API_KEY你的Taotoken_API_Key请将你的Taotoken_API_Key替换为你在Taotoken控制台创建的真实API Key。务必确保.env文件已被添加到.gitignore中以避免密钥泄露。在某些使用场景下模型ID可能需要在你创建的具体Agent实例配置中指定而不是在全局配置里。请根据你的项目结构和Hermes Agent的文档进行相应设置。4. 验证配置与发起请求完成配置后建议编写一个简单的测试脚本来验证连接是否正常。以下是一个使用Node.js SDK的验证示例import { Hermes } from hermes-agent; // 假设的导入方式请以实际SDK为准 // 根据你的配置方式初始化Hermes // 如果配置正确SDK会自动使用 .env 中的 OPENAI_API_KEY 和配置文件中的 base_url const agent new Hermes({ provider: custom, baseURL: https://taotoken.net/api/v1, model: claude-sonnet-4-6, // 指定测试模型 }); // 发起一个简单的测试请求 async function testConnection() { try { const response await agent.chat(Hello, world!); console.log(配置成功模型回复, response); } catch (error) { console.error(请求失败请检查配置, error.message); // 常见问题base_url错误、API Key无效、模型ID不存在 } } testConnection();运行测试脚本如果能看到模型的正常回复则说明Taotoken平台已成功集成到你的Hermes Agent项目中。如果遇到错误请依次检查base_url是否准确写为https://taotoken.net/api/v1。API Key是否正确无误且具有足够的余额或调用权限。模型ID是否在Taotoken平台支持且可用的列表中。通过以上步骤你就可以在Hermes Agent框架中灵活使用Taotoken平台聚合的各类大模型了。关于更高级的用法例如在多个自定义供应商间切换请查阅Hermes Agent的官方文档。开始你的Hermes Agent项目集成可以访问 Taotoken 创建API Key并查看所有可用模型。 告别海外账号与网络限制稳定直连全球优质大模型限时半价接入中。 点击领取海量免费额度